Noah Malone to be Honored During Colts Game on October 17

TERRE HAUTE, Ind. – Indiana State track & field student-athlete Noah Malone will be honored Sunday, October 17 during the Indianapolis Colts game against Houston. Kickoff is set for 1 p.m. ET at Lucas Oil Stadium.
 
Malone is coming off the Tokyo Paralympics where he brough home three medals, including a gold medal. Malone, acted as the opening leg of the 4x100 relay, where his team went on to set a new world record time of 45.52.
 
His victory as a member of the team gave him his third medal of the Paralympics after picking up silver medals in both the 100 and 400-meter dashes, both of which also came courtesy of new American records with times of 10.55 and 47.93, respectively.
 
Malone is the first Sycamore track & field athlete to medal at either the Olympic or Paralympic games and just the second to make Team USA after Felisha Johnson qualified for the 2016 Rio Olympics.
